Dr. Akinwumi Adesina Sworn In As AfDB President

by InlandTown Editor
0 comment

Following his re-election by unanimous vote in August 27, 2020, Dr. Akinwumi Adesina has been sworn-in to retain his position as the President of the African Development Bank .

The swearing-in and oath-taking ceremony took place on Tuesday and was broadcast virtually. Ghana’s Finance Minister and the Chairperson of the AfDB board of Governors, Kenneth Ofori-Attah, administered the oath of office.

The event was graced by eminent personalities such as the Heads of States, Governors , Nigerian’s ex Vice President, Atiku Abubakar and over 200 external stakeholders who joined physically and virtually.

Dr. Akinwumi Adesina served under the Goodluck Ebele Jonathan’s administration as Nigeria’s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development. He was re-elected unanimously for his second term, which will span through another 5 years; following votes from Governors, regional and non-regional members of the Bank.
